The video tutorial explains the concept of IO redirection in Linux, covering standard input, output, and error. It describes how file descriptors are used to manage these IO types and demonstrates various redirection techniques, including redirecting output to files, appending outputs, and using the null device to discard unwanted data. Practical examples illustrate how to handle errors and combine outputs effectively.
